Molecular engineering and sequential cosensitization for preventing the “trade-off” effect with photovoltaic enhancement
In dye-sensitized solar cells (DSSCs), it is essential to use rational molecular design to obtain promising photosensitizers with well-matched energy levels and narrow optical band gaps.
